Understanding Margin Trading

Margin trading involves using borrowed funds to increase your position size, enabling you to trade with leverage.

For example, if you start a margin trade with 2x leverage and your assets increase in value by 10%, your profit will double to 20% because of the leverage applied.

In a standard trade, your leverage would typically be 1:1, meaning you’re only trading with the amount you actually own.

The reason margin trading is possible is that there’s a lending market where lenders provide funds to traders in exchange for interest.

This system benefits both parties—traders gain access to additional funds to increase their potential earnings, while lenders earn passive income through interest.

Some exchanges, such as Poloniex, allow registered users to lend Bitcoin and altcoins to traders, whereas others, like Bitfinex, provide funds directly to traders.

However, a key drawback for lenders is that they must store their assets on the exchange instead of keeping them in a private wallet, increasing security risks.

Risks Associated with Margin Trading

Before engaging in margin trading, it’s crucial to understand the risks involved. The costs include interest on borrowed funds and trading fees charged by the exchange.

The greater the potential profit, the higher the risk of loss. The worst-case scenario is losing your entire investment, which is known as liquidation.

Liquidation occurs when the value of your position drops to a certain point, at which the exchange automatically closes it to prevent further losses beyond your own capital. For example, if you use 1:1 leverage, you won’t have a liquidation risk because you’re only trading with your own money.

However, if you use 2:1 leverage and purchase Bitcoin worth $1,000, you’ll be borrowing an additional $1,000, making your total position $2,000. In this case, your liquidation value would be $500 because if the Bitcoin price drops to that level, you’ll lose your initial investment along with the trading fees.

Since margin trading increases exposure to the market, it also amplifies risks. If prices swing significantly, traders can be forced into liquidation, losing their investment.

Best Practices for Margin Trading

1. Risk Management

Discipline is essential when trading with leverage. Set clear limits on how much you’re willing to risk and avoid overextending yourself. Establish a stop-loss strategy to protect your investment, ensuring that you close positions at a predetermined loss to minimize potential damage.

2. Market Monitoring

Cryptocurrency prices are highly volatile, making margin trading even riskier. To reduce exposure to extreme price fluctuations, focus on short-term leveraged positions. Although daily margin trading fees may seem low, they can accumulate over time, impacting your profitability.

3. Handling Market Fluctuations

Since crypto prices can swing unpredictably, leverage should be used strategically. If prices drop too much, they may hit your liquidation threshold, particularly when using high leverage.

Consider using price dips to your advantage by setting exit targets to lock in profits when prices rebound.

Should You Engage in Margin Trading?

Margin trading is best suited for experienced traders who understand market trends, leverage ratios, and risk management strategies.

If you prefer a cautious approach, conduct thorough research on the exchange you plan to use. Familiarize yourself with margin ratios, liquidation mechanisms, and margin calls before executing leveraged trades.

Also, develop a well-structured trading strategy and understand how technical indicators can guide decision-making.

Risk Assessment: Ratios, Loss Potential, and Trade Size

Cryptocurrency margin trading is inherently high-risk. Unlike traditional investments, a bad trade can wipe out your entire capital. The greater the leverage, the faster potential losses can accumulate.

For example, if you invest $25 of your own money and borrow $75 (4:1 leverage), a 25% drop in price would trigger liquidation, wiping out your initial $25 investment.

Higher leverage speeds up liquidation—an 8:1 leverage position will be liquidated at a 12.5% price drop, while a 2:1 leverage position is called at a 50% loss. To avoid liquidation, traders may need to add more capital, but this can spiral into a deeper financial loss.

Tax Implications of Margin Trading

Since traders frequently experience capital gains and losses, short-term trading profits are often subject to taxation. Holding cryptocurrencies for extended periods may reduce tax liabilities, as long-term capital gains are typically taxed at lower rates than short-term gains.
